Study of Local Binary Pattern for Partial Fingerprint Identification

Journal Title: International Journal of Modern Engineering Research (IJMER) - Year 2014, Vol 4, Issue 9

Abstract

Fingerprints are usually used in recognition of a person's identity because of its uniqueness, stability. Today also the matching of incomplete or partial fingerprints remains challenge. The current technology is somewhat mature for matching ten prints, but matching of partial fingerprints still needs a lot of improvement. Automatic fingerprint identification techniques have been successfully adapted to both civilian and forensic applications. But this Fingerprint identification system suffers from the problem of andling incomplete prints and discards any partial fingerprints obtained. Level 2 features are very efficient if the quality of achievement decreases the number of level 2 features will not be enough for establishing high accuracy in identification. In such cases pores (level 3 features) can be used for partial fingerprint matching with the help of suitable technique local binary pattern features. Local binary pattern feature is used to match the pore against with full fingerprints. The first step involves extracting the pores from the partial image. These pores act as anchor points and sub window (32*32) is formed surrounding the pores. Then rotation invariant LBP histograms are obtained from the surrounding window. Finally chi-square formula is used to calculate the minimum distance between two histograms to find best matching score
